Introduction
A Control Expert project that includes the 140CRA31908 adapter module requires the assembly of these local and remote racks:
Rack Type
Description
local
M580 rack
The M580 CPU on this rack is the processor for the network.
remote
X80 remote rack
This rack includes a 140CRA31908 module and a 140CRP93•00 communications module.
Quantum S908 remote rack
This rack includes a drop-end communicator that corresponds to the drop type (S908, 800 Series, SY/MAX).
The following tables describe the configuration of these racks in a Control Expert project.
NOTE: Create a Control Expert project that corresponds to the hardware and cabling considerations of your physical M580 network architecture.
Assemble an M580 Local Rack
Create an M580 local rack in Control Expert:
Step
Action
1
Create a new project in Control Expert (File → New).
2
In the New Project window, expand (+) the Modicon M580 menu.
3
Select an M580 PLC for your project. For this example, select a BMEP584040 PLC.
NOTE: Refer to the list of supported PLCs.
4
Press OK to create a Project Browser view of the new project.
NOTE: Because the selected CPU (BMEP584040) uses the EIO scanner service, a PLC bus and an EIO Bus are automatically added to the Configuration in the Project Browser.
5
Add more modules to the PLC Bus. (For this example, this step is optional. Select modules that conform to your network design and application.)
6
Save the project (File → Save).
Assemble an X80 Remote Drop
An X80 remote drop in an M580 network has these components:
Add an X80 remote drop supporting S908 to the configuration:
Step
Action
1
Double-click EIO Bus in the Configuration in the Project Browser.
2
In the EIO Bus window, double-click the square link connector to access a list of available racks.
3
For this example, expand (+) these menus in the New Device window:
  • Quantum S908 remote drop
  • Rack
4
For this example, double-click 140XBP00400 to see a four-slot rack for the Quantum S908 remote drop.
NOTE: Control Expert automatically adds a 140CRA31908 adapter module in first slot of the rack. (You can move this module to a different slot if you wish.)
5
Save the project (File → Save).
Add a remote head module to the Quantum remote drop supporting S908:
Step
Action
1
In the EIO Bus window, double-click an empty slot.
2
For this example, expand (+) these items in the Part Number column of the New Device window:
  • Quantum S908 remote drop
  • Communication
3
Select 140 CRP 93X 00 and press OK to install the 140CRP93•00 communication module on the X80 remote drop.
NOTE: Because the selected 140CRP93•00 module manages communications with a Quantum S908 remote drop, Control Expert automatically adds an RIO Bus to the Configuration in the Project Browser.
4
Double-click any empty slot to add modules to the EIO Bus. (For this example, this step is optional.)
5
Save the project (File → Save).
Assemble a Quantum S908 Remote Drop
Add a Quantum S908 remote drop to the RIO Bus:
Step
Action
1
Double-click RIO Bus in the Configuration in the Project Browser.
2
In the RIO Bus window, double-click the square link connector to access the available racks.
3
Expand (+) these items in the Part Number column of the New Device window to see the available drop types:
  • 800IO Drop
  • Remote IO Quantum Drop
  • SY/MAX Drop
4
For this example, expand Remote IO Quantum Drop.
5
Double-click 140 XBP 004 00.
NOTE: Because the selected rack accommodates S908 I/O modules, Control Expert automatically adds a 140CRA93X00 drop end communicator to slot 1. (You can move the module to a different slot if you wish.)
6
Double-click any empty slot to add modules to the RIO Bus. (For this example, this step is optional.)
7
Save the project (File → Save).
You can now double-click the 140CRA31908 module in the Quantum S908 remote drop to access its configuration tabs.
